Plugins löschen / deinstallieren

  • Hallo zusammen,


    ich habe damals zu testzwecken aus dem Plugin-Store "Mailgraph" und "SpamAssassin" installiert, ohne zuvor etwas wie im FAQ zu sehen zu konfigurieren (Nur hochgeladen). Nun versuche ich die Plugins verzweifelt wieder zu löschen, allerdings klappt das nicht. Weder Deinstallieren noch löschen kann ich das Ganze. Bei Status steht "Unbekannter Fehler".


    Mailgraph - Fehlerdetails


    Ein unerwarteter Fehler ist aufgetreten:


    Modules::Plugin::_exec: Can't locate RRDs.pm in @INC (@INC contains: /var/www/imscp/engine /var/www/imscp/engine/PerlLib /var/www/imscp/engine/PerlVendor /etc/perl /usr/local/lib/perl/5.14.2 /usr/local/share/perl/5.14.2 /usr/lib/perl5 /usr/share/perl5 /usr/lib/perl/5.14 /usr/share/perl/5.14 /usr/local/lib/site_perl .) at /var/www/imscp/engine/Plugins/Mailgraph.pm line 36.
    BEGIN failed--compilation aborted at /var/www/imscp/engine/Plugins/Mailgraph.pm line 36.
    Compilation failed in require at /var/www/imscp/engine/PerlLib/Modules/Plugin.pm line 417.

    SpamAssassin - Fehlerdetails

    Ein unerwarteter Fehler ist aufgetreten:


    Plugin::SpamAssassin::install: Unable to find SpamAssassin daemon. Please, install the spamassassin packages first.


    Nur zum Verständnis - Ich will die Liste lediglich bereinigen, sodass die Plugins nicht mehr angezeigt werden!


    Danke schon einmal im Voraus für Eure Hilfe.


    Gruß Kuhlma

  • Gehe einfach in /var/www/imscp/gui/plugins dort liegsemtlicche plugins denn löschen und in kontroll pannel aktualesieren denn solten sie gelöscht sein.

    my System :

    - Distribution: Debian | Release: 9.13 | Codename: wheezy
    - i-MSCP Version: i-MSCP 1.5.3| Build: 20181208 | Codename: Ennio Morricone
    - Plugins installed: ClamAV (v. 1.3.0), Mailgraph (v 1.1.1), OpenDKIM (v 2.0.0), SpamAssassin (v 2.0.1)
    - LetsEncrypt (v3.3.0), PhpSwitcher (v 5.0.5), RoundcubePlugins (v 2.0.2)YubiKeyAuth 1.1.0

  • Das alleine scheint nichts zu bringen, zumindest sind die Plugins im Panel noch zu sehen!

  • hast du unten auf aktualsieren gemacht oder mach mal updates klicken.

    my System :

    - Distribution: Debian | Release: 9.13 | Codename: wheezy
    - i-MSCP Version: i-MSCP 1.5.3| Build: 20181208 | Codename: Ennio Morricone
    - Plugins installed: ClamAV (v. 1.3.0), Mailgraph (v 1.1.1), OpenDKIM (v 2.0.0), SpamAssassin (v 2.0.1)
    - LetsEncrypt (v3.3.0), PhpSwitcher (v 5.0.5), RoundcubePlugins (v 2.0.2)YubiKeyAuth 1.1.0

  • Ah alles klar, habe lediglich die Seite aktualisiert (F5). Wenn man es richtig macht, klappt es auch. Danke ;)

  • Sauberer wäre es die plugins in der imscp-db mit der flag disabled zu versehen und das Setup bzw den Installer neu auszuführen :)

  • Es ist ein älterer Thread, aber für den 1.2.x branch bin ich ebenfalls über ein vergleichbares Problem gestolpert. Neben dem plugin steht Unbekannter Fehler und es gibt keine Schaltflächen mehr. Im Hinweistext wird z.B. auf die fehlende Installation von policyd-weight hingewiesen.


    Hiervon betroffen sind wohl nur plugins, die einen Eingriff als Root, z.B. die Installation eines Programms, wie z.B. policyd-weight, voraussetzen, diese aber nicht durchgeführt wurde und auch nicht durchgeführt werden sollen.


    Ich habe den Hinweis von Ninos aufgegriffen und konnte für diesen Fall folgendes Prozedere erfolgreich druchführen:


    1. In der Datenbank imscp in der Tabelle plugin in das Feld plugin_status den Wert disabled eintragen und das Feld plugin_error leeren.
    2. Im Panel beim plugin auf die Fehlerbeschreibung klicken und Wiederholung erwzingen klicken.


    Nun steht der Status auf deaktiviert und man kann das plugin sauber deinstallieren.